To determine whether the relationship between mean arterial pressure (MAP) and cerebral hemodynamics persists throughout … Web17 jan. 2024 · Flow is the movement of a liquid or gas over time. Flow can be calculated by multiplying velocity, the distance moved by an object over time, with cross-sectional area. Within the circulatory system, velocity can be altered by changes in blood pressure, vessel resistance, and blood viscosity.

WebBecause the rest of the body gets the message to constrict the blood vessels and the muscles dilate their blood vessels, blood flow from nonessential organs (for example, stomach, intestines and kidney) is diverted to working muscle.
